Alzamora Group opened the doors of its headquarters in Olot to professionals from various companies and industries as part of a Factory Tour: a guided professional visit, designed to demonstrate in a direct and practical way how the Lean Manufacturing culture is integrated into its processes and management model.
During the event, attendees representing nine organizations from different sectors toured the facilities and learned how Lean methodologies, from the most visual to the most analytical, are applied with a focus on sustainability throughout the entire value stream.
Visitors were able to observe standardized and highly organized processes, work methods focused on efficiency and waste elimination, and Lean tools applied daily that add real value to the end customer.
Terms such as SMED (rapid reduction of machine changeover times), VSM (value stream mapping), Ishikawa (root cause analysis), PDCA (continuous improvement cycle: plan, do, check, act), Lean Office (application of Lean in administrative processes), Visual Management (visual tools to control processes) or even Process Digitalization (use of digital technologies to optimize operations) were tangible examples of how an industrial company can operate.
Participants particularly appreciated seeing how a Lean philosophy translates into action: from the commitment of operational teams to upward communication tools such as the PDCA cycle applied to continuous improvement.
